Subject: [PATCH tip/core/rcu 01/12] rcu: Consolidate rcu_synchronize and wakeme_after_rcu()

There are currently duplicate identical definitions of the
rcu_synchronize() structure and the wakeme_after_rcu() function.
Thie commit therefore consolidates them.
Signed-off-by: Paul E. McKenney <paulmck@linux.vnet.ibm.com>
---
include/linux/rcupdate.h | 9 +++++++++
kernel/rcu/srcu.c | 17 -----------------
kernel/rcu/update.c | 15 ++++++---------
3 files changed, 15 insertions(+), 26 deletions(-)
diff --git a/include/linux/rcupdate.h b/include/linux/rcupdate.h
index 78097491cd99..3e6afed51051 100644
--- a/include/linux/rcupdate.h
+++ b/include/linux/rcupdate.h
@@ -195,6 +195,15 @@ void call_rcu_sched(struct rcu_head *head,
void synchronize_sched(void);
+/*
+ * Structure allowing asynchronous waiting on RCU.
+ */
+struct rcu_synchronize {
+ struct rcu_head head;
+ struct completion completion;
+};
+void wakeme_after_rcu(struct rcu_head *head);
+
/**
* call_rcu_tasks() - Queue an RCU for invocation task-based grace period
* @head: structure to be used for queueing the RCU updates.
diff --git a/kernel/rcu/srcu.c b/kernel/rcu/srcu.c
index 445bf8ffe3fb..81f53b504c18 100644
--- a/kernel/rcu/srcu.c
+++ b/kernel/rcu/srcu.c
@@ -402,23 +402,6 @@ void call_srcu(struct srcu_struct *sp, struct rcu_head *head,
}
EXPORT_SYMBOL_GPL(call_srcu);
-struct rcu_synchronize {
- struct rcu_head head;
- struct completion completion;
-};
-
-/*
- * Awaken the corresponding synchronize_srcu() instance now that a
- * grace period has elapsed.
- */
-static void wakeme_after_rcu(struct rcu_head *head)
-{
- struct rcu_synchronize *rcu;
-
- rcu = container_of(head, struct rcu_synchronize, head);
- complete(&rcu->completion);
-}
-
static void srcu_advance_batches(struct srcu_struct *sp, int trycount);
static void srcu_reschedule(struct srcu_struct *sp);
diff --git a/kernel/rcu/update.c b/kernel/rcu/update.c
index e0d31a345ee6..8864ed90f0d7 100644
--- a/kernel/rcu/update.c
+++ b/kernel/rcu/update.c
@@ -199,16 +199,13 @@ EXPORT_SYMBOL_GPL(rcu_read_lock_bh_held);
#endif /* #ifdef CONFIG_DEBUG_LOCK_ALLOC */
-struct rcu_synchronize {
- struct rcu_head head;
- struct completion completion;
-};
-
-/*
- * Awaken the corresponding synchronize_rcu() instance now that a
- * grace period has elapsed.
+/**
+ * wakeme_after_rcu() - Callback function to awaken a task after grace period
+ * @head: Pointer to rcu_head member within rcu_synchronize structure
+ *
+ * Awaken the corresponding task now that a grace period has elapsed.
*/
-static void wakeme_after_rcu(struct rcu_head *head)
+void wakeme_after_rcu(struct rcu_head *head)
{
struct rcu_synchronize *rcu;
